print_r(변수명)
var_dump(변수명)
이렇게 많이들 하시는데요,
라이믹스의 디버깅 기능을 이용해보세요.
{@ debugPrint($logged_info)}
이런식으로 스킨에서도 충분히 활용이 가능합니다.
다만 디버그 설정에서 웹으로 보거나 파일로 보는 것을 선택할 수 있는데 추천하자면 파일로 선택한다음 해당 파일을
터미널상에서 해당 파일위치찾았다면 tail -f _파일명 및 디렉토리.php 이런형태로 명령어로 실행하는 것을 추천합니다. 실시간으로 디버그 찍히는 내용들을 충분히 받아볼 수 있으며, 디버그가 쌓일때 곤란할 수 잇으니 디버그 설정에서 특정 아이피에서 채크 하는 기능을 사용하세요. 특정아이피에서 접속할때만 디버깅이 작동되어서 변수 및 내용들을 활용할 수 있고 이 경우 모듈을 만들때 POST요청시 생성되는 모든 액션들까지 전부 디버깅을 할 수 있어서 어디 특정 액션에 들어갔는지 채크 할 필요도 없이 확인이 가능할때가 많습니다.
이 기능도 많이 활용했으면 좋겠네요.
ETC) debugPrint 라는 것은 함수명이니 함수명을 호출하는곳은 라이믹스가 실행되는 어떤 공간에서든지 displayHandler가 작동한다면 디버깅을 확인할 수 있습니다. 언제든지 이 부분도 함께 확인하세요. 기본 POST요청시 displayHandler도 함께 작동하여 정상적으로 디버깅을 출력해줍니다.